Abstract

Bangladesh is one of many such countries that are in immediate need to imply concepts of environmental to deal with crises like water, climate change, and so on. Green pedagogy is a permanent process in which individuals and communities become aware of their environment and learn the knowledge, values, skills, and determination to act individually and collectively to solve present and future ecological problems. The purpose of the incorporation of ecological education into teaching English language is to raise ecological awareness of global ecological problems. To be able to take part in this solution process English language learners should especially have critical thinking and critical reading skills. Ecological education practices can be incorporated in English language teaching by fostering critical skills with the suggested approach and authentic texts on ecological issues can be used as classroom material for this purpose. Thus there is a need for a practical framework to guide teachers in the effective implementation of environmental and sustainability concepts in English as a second language.Keywords: Teaching, second language, green pedagogy, sustainability, environment, Bangladesh
